A description of the dynamic behavior of fuzzy systems

IEEE Transactions on Systems, Man, and Cybernetics, 1989
An approach is presented for analyzing the global behavior of a fuzzy dynamical system that applies the concept and method of cell-to-cell mapping to obtain the evolving trend of the states of a fuzzy dynamical system. The behavior of the fuzzy system is characterized by equilibria, periodic motions, and their domain of attractions.

Energetistic stability of fuzzy dynamic systems

IEEE Transactions on Systems, Man, and Cybernetics, 1985
A notion of stability of fuzzy dynamical systems governed by a fuzzy relational equation \(X_{k+1}=U_ k\circ X_ k\circ R\) with \(U_ k\) being a fuzzy control, \(X_ k\), \(X_{k+1}\) forming fuzzy state sets and R denoting a fuzzy relation (viz. \(U_ k:U\to [0,1]\), \(X_ k\), \(X_{k+1}:X\to [0,1]\), R:\(U\times X\times X\to [0,1])\) is discussed.

Fuzzy stopping in continuous-time dynamic fuzzy systems

Fuzzy Sets and Systems, 2002
The paper discusses a stopping problem in continuous-time dynamic fuzzy system, using fuzzy stopping times, under some different estimation of fuzzy rewards. The paper develops fuzzy stopping times in a continuous time fuzzy system. Also the paper presents the optimality equations for the optimal fuzzy rewards in terms of variational inequalities.
